AgustaWestland Philadelphia Corporation Mechanical Technician in PHILADELPHIA, Pennsylvania

 

*Summary of Position: *

The technician will be responsible for installing all mechanical parts on the assembly of the helicopter, such as rotor head, transmissions, engines, hydraulic lines and flight controls, working in areas that may be cramped and/or little room.   The technician will work from engineering drawings and job cards and follow the production schedule.

The technician must be able to work through obstacles and know the best method to perform the job.
